PolyMedica says request reveals four customer complaints
WOBURN, Mass., March 23 (Reuters) - Medical services company PolyMedica Corp. (NASDAQ:PLMD) said on Friday that a Freedom of Information Act inquiry showed that the company received four customer complaints in June 1999.

The distributor of home test kits, syringes and other supplies to diabetes patients said that an analyst requested the documents but that no one in the senior management of the firm had been contacted by the government about the complaints. The company did not specify the nature of the reports from the customers but said it ships between 60,000 and 90,000 orders per month.

PolyMedica said the analyst made the request for the documents because of investigations being conducted by the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services.

The company said it issued the statement late Friday in response to a recent decline in its stock price, which plunged $16-11/16, or almost 50 percent, to $17 on Friday.
